About Wonjun Kim

Wonjun Kim is a scholar working on Computer Vision and Pattern Recognition, Media Technology, Signal Processing, Biomedical Engineering and Computational Mechanics, having authored 86 papers that have together received 1.4k indexed citations. Recurring topics across this work include Video Surveillance and Tracking Methods (22 papers), Image Enhancement Techniques (18 papers), Advanced Vision and Imaging (16 papers), Human Pose and Action Recognition (14 papers), Visual Attention and Saliency Detection (12 papers), Advanced Image Processing Techniques (9 papers), Advanced Image and Video Retrieval Techniques (9 papers) and Biometric Identification and Security (8 papers). The work is most often cited by research in Computer Vision and Pattern Recognition (1.1k citations), Media Technology (326 citations), Signal Processing (142 citations), Sensory Systems (46 citations) and Human-Computer Interaction (43 citations). Wonjun Kim has collaborated with scholars based in South Korea, Japan and United States. Frequent co-authors include Seokjae Lim, Changick Kim, Chanho Jung, Jae‐Joon Han, Sungjoo Suh, Jonghee Kim, Seokeon Choi, Youngsung Kim, Minwoo Park and Sang-Hwan Lee. Their work appears in journals such as IEEE Signal Processing Letters, IEEE Access, Journal of Visual Communication and Image Representation, Multimedia Systems and Multimedia Tools and Applications.
